Winnipeg police arrested a man and woman late Friday after seizing an air pistol and drugs during a proactive patrol in the North End.
Shortly before midnight on Aug. 30, North District General Patrol officers approached a pair who were standing next to a vehicle in a commercial parking lot in the 200 block of McGregor Street. Businesses in the area were closed at the time.
Officers noticed a firearm in plain view inside the vehicle. Both individuals were taken into custody, and the vehicle was searched. Police seized a Beretta-style air pistol, about 20 grams of cocaine valued at $2,000, 22 grams of methamphetamine worth $1,100, 73 gabapentin pills valued at $220, a cell phone, a scale, and $625 in cash.
